Cornstarch Vs Cornmeal. If you read a british or irish cookbook, you may be confused by the fact that what we call cornstarch, they call “corn flour.” in the states, corn flour is just dried corn that’s milled. Corn meal, corn flour, and. Yes, they’re both made from corn, but they are quite different in flavour, use &. They are technically both made from corn, but cornstarch is made from only the endosperms found in the middle of corn kernels, while cornmeal is made from dried and ground dent corn.
